The Digitalisation Of The Pharmaceutical Cold Chain

The viability of temperature-sensitive pharmaceuticals requires stringent care to be taken during the transport and storage of products.

The pharmaceutical industry has faced increased pressure and demand in the last two years. As expected, greater research, time and funds have been invested into the industry to ensure it can meet growing demands. Furthermore, pharmaceutical cold chain logistics has also demonstrated a significant increase due to greater demands and sales globally. No doubt, global vaccine distribution has contributed to the growth of the industry. The global pharmaceutical industry is projected to be worth $1700.97 billion by 2025 at a CAGR of 8%, as reported by Research and Markets. With the industry rapidly growing, pharmaceutical cold chain management plays a crucial role in ensuring that product losses and damages do not occur. The utilisation of IoT enabled asset tracking solutions enables the safe and accurate monitoring of temperature-sensitive products throughout the pharmaceutical cold chain. 

 

Temperature-sensitive products require stringent care to be taken during pharmaceutical cold chain management particularly during the transport and storage of products. Even the slightest temperature excursions, exposure to light and shock can affect the viability of pharmaceuticals. As reported by NSW Health, temperature-sensitive pharmaceuticals such as vaccines must be consistently kept between 2–8 degrees Celsius to ensure its longevity and viability. However, some pharmaceuticals, are required to be kept as low as -70 degrees Celsius. 

 

Biopharmaceuticals are expensive to manufacture and are highly sensitive to elements such as light and temperature fluctuations due to their live compounds. Through the utilisation of a digital temperature monitoring system such as Adapt Ideations’ PIXEL, the pharmaceutical industry can ensure temperature-sensitive pharmaceuticals are stored in the correct conditions during cold storage. 

 

The warehousing, storage and transport of pharmaceuticals is an important process within the supply chain, that is often forgotten. A report released by The International Air Transport Association (IATA), highlighted that temperature-sensitive airfreight also experience breaks in the cold chain. The report found that the pharmaceutical industry loses $2.5 billion to $12.5 billion annually due to this challenge. These challenges highlight the importance of effective and reliable pharmaceutical cold chain management. Evolution of Temperature-Controlled Logistics Temperature control has undergone a remarkable transformation in the last two decades. Stringent global regulations, customer demand for new temperature ranges, emerging markets with extreme temperatures, and the growing value of drugs like biologics have been essential driving forces. These factors have spurred the evolution of temperature-controlled logistics to meet the demands of a rapidly changing world. The landscape of temperature-controlled logistics is evolving, thanks to technological advancements. Trends include the growing availability of prequalified shippers simplifying the validation process, sophisticated supply chain services, a rising interest in reusable packaging, and advances in temperature-monitoring technology. These innovations contribute to the industry's ability to adapt and thrive in a dynamic environment. Temperature-controlled logistics involves managing the flow of products through a cold chain. Divided into food and pharmaceutical sectors, the global market size of cold chain logistics is projected to grow significantly. From USD 242.39 billion in 2021 to USD 647.47 billion by 2028, exhibiting a CAGR of 15.1%, the industry is expanding rapidly, reflecting its critical role in modern commerce. 3 Key Challenges in Temperature-Controlled Logistics Compliance Issues Stringent Regulatory Standards: Global temperature-controlled logistics operates within a framework of strict regulations set by health and safety authorities. Meeting diverse regulatory requirements across international borders poses a significant challenge for companies in this sector. Documentation & Reporting: Compliance involves meticulous documentation and reporting of temperature-sensitive shipments. Keeping up with the evolving documentation standards requires streamlined processes and robust systems. Validation & Qualification: Ensuring the validation and qualification of equipment and processes according to regulatory standards is an ongoing challenge. The need for continuous validation adds complexity and time constraints to logistics operations. Risks of Temperature Deviations Product Integrity: Temperature-sensitive products, especially pharmaceuticals and biologics, are highly susceptible to temperature deviations. Even brief exposure to temperature breaches during transit can compromise the integrity and efficacy of these products. Financial Implications: Temperature deviations can lead to significant financial losses for companies. Replacing or disposing of compromised products and potential legal repercussions contribute to financial challenges. Supply Chain Disruptions: Temperature deviations can disrupt the entire supply chain, leading to delays in product availability. This not only affects businesses but can have critical implications for healthcare providers and patients relying on timely access to medications. Security & Theft Concerns Value of Cargo: Temperature-sensitive cargo, such as pharmaceuticals, vaccines, and high-value perishable goods, can become a target for theft. The significant value of these products heightens security concerns throughout the supply chain. Vulnerability During Transit: The vulnerability of cargo during transit, particularly in unsecured areas, poses a constant risk. The potential for theft during transportation adds complexity to securing temperature-controlled shipments. Need for Tracking & Monitoring: Ensuring the security of temperature-sensitive cargo requires robust tracking and monitoring systems. Integrating security features, such as real-time location tracking and tamper-evident technologies, is essential to mitigate theft risks. In navigating the intricate landscape of temperature-controlled logistics, companies must address these multifaceted challenges to uphold compliance, safeguard product integrity, and ensure the security of valuable shipments. Innovative solutions, such as advanced monitoring technologies and comprehensive security measures, are crucial in overcoming these challenges and fostering a resilient and efficient supply chain.
